ACCIDENTS AND FATALITIES.
-COEONEE'S INQUEST.: ■'- A SAD CASE. At the hospital, yesterday afternoon, before Mr. W. G. Eiddell, District Coroner, an inquest .touching' the death of David -Henry Tobin, who attempts suicide by ishooting, himself in the head, with a revolver,, at his residence in Jessie Street, on January 17, was hold. ' , Dr. Kington .'-Fyffe deposed that /death w-as 1 due to-tuberculosis of the lungs and a secondary abscess of tho brain.' Dr. Brown, assistant surgeon.. at • the hospital,, stated-- that ' the deceased had : been, in,:.the»institution;. fori a-fortnight,'-and was discharged, • at his orai' desire; on January' 15. On January 17, at 7.45 Psm., he; was readmitted suffering'from a; bullet wound in -the right temple, l but was quite conscious. The'patient made satisfactory-., progress .until January 26, when 'symptoms of pressure.on the Win : developed,-'and he died, at 2.45 a:m. 'the [ following; day. : ■ Henrietta Tobin, wife .of the deceased,' said that her husband, a wharf labourer, fell, down the'hold of-the Turakina. three years ago, and luul never been well sinco. He had: suffered.' from consumption for' six y«o,rs. . He had recently been' depressed, and, on - the evening of January 17 ho came home, , and went to bed. During- her absence from -;the ; room he shot himself ip- the. head with. a Tevolver. : A .finding, in accordance frith the. medical evidence was' returned. \ ' SUDDEN DEATH. , A man named ,G.Throssell, sixty years of age, . residing at the Lower Hutt, dropped dead in a billiard-saloon at the Hutt last , evening. ■- The deceased,: who . has, it,is understood, no relatives in: New Zealand, was formerly book-keeper in the employ of Mr. Thomas.Burt, of tho Hutt He formerly resided at Hopper Street, Wellington.
